Significance

Earlier, the authors have reported enantioselective copper-catalyzed additions of enamides and enecarbamates to various electrophiles. In the present study a chiral copper diamine complex is found to catalyze the addition of a variety of aromatic and alkyl-substituted en­amides to several diaryl ethylidenemalonates in good to excellent yields and enantioselectivities. As an advantage over related methods, the requisite proton transfer step occurs intramolecularly, provided from the enamide as opposed to an external source.
